YouTube Music, the music streaming service from Google, is marking its 10th anniversary with a suite of new features designed to enhance user experience and compete with industry leaders like Spotify. The service, which launched in 2015, has grown significantly over the years, now boasting over 125 million users as of March 2025, up from 100 million in February 2024 [1].The new features include "Taste Match" playlists, which combine users' overlapping musical interests, similar to Spotify's Blend playlists. These playlists are generated by analyzing users' music tastes and creating shared playlists that are automatically updated daily. Additionally, YouTube Music has partnered with Bandsintown to provide users with notifications about upcoming concerts, album releases, and merchandise drops, expanding its offerings to include event discovery and ticket sales in 35 countries [1].
YouTube Music's catalog has also grown significantly, now containing over 300 million tracks, including studio recordings, live performances, remixes, and covers. The service offers over 4 billion music-focused user-generated playlists, with 1.8 billion of those being public. This extensive catalog allows users to explore a wide range of music and discover new artists and genres [2].
To foster community engagement, YouTube Music has introduced new features that allow users to leave comments on albums and playlists, as well as earn loyalty badges for their activity on the platform. These badges, which include categories like "First Listener" and "Top Listener," encourage users to engage with the service and reward their dedication to specific artists or genres [1].
The growth of YouTube Music can be attributed to its focus on user experience and community engagement. The service has evolved from its early days as a platform for ad-supported music to a subscription-based service with a global footprint. By continuously innovating and expanding its features, YouTube Music has positioned itself as a strong competitor in the streaming market [1].
